Opened in August 2020 as the flagship of the innovative Nikko Style brand, this contemporary lifestyle hotel redefines the Japanese hospitality experience. Recognized as a TripAdvisor Travelers’ Choice winner, placing it among the top 10% of hotels worldwide, Nikko Style Nagoya seamlessly blends modern design with comfort, specialty coffee, and curated sound.
Strategically positioned just 10 minutes on foot from Nagoya Station and 4 minutes from Kokusai Center Station, the hotel offers unparalleled access to shopping, dining, and major city attractions. The central Meieki location provides urban convenience while maintaining surprising tranquility.
The hotel’s defining character revolves around coffee culture and music. Renowned sound director Kenichiro Nishihara composed carefully selected background music in 24-hour cycles where songs never repeat, creating different moods for morning, noon, and night. The welcoming lobby buzzes with locals and tourists enjoying specialty coffee, fostering a vibrant community atmosphere that breaks away from sterile business hotel traditions.
The on-site style kitchen restaurant serves contemporary cuisine using seasonal ingredients, while the adjoining Café & Bar showcases specialty coffee blends created in collaboration with local roastery TRUNK COFFEE. Using rare beans representing just 5% of global production, coffee is served in custom Mino-yaki pottery cups.
Guests enjoy 24-hour fitness center access, rental bikes including children’s options, event space, and unique in-room Hand-Drip Coffee Sets. The entire property is non-smoking with high-speed internet.
Accessibility
Hotel Nikko Style Nagoya has one designated universal room, Room 201, located on the second floor. This room is equipped with two single beds and adjustable support rails positioned on each side to assist with transfers. The floor layout allows for wheelchair maneuverability, and the room features flat, step-free flooring. Entry is facilitated by a card key system. A sofa and table are positioned near the window, with space for lateral access.
The en-suite bathroom includes a toilet with foldable support rails on both sides and a sink with clearance underneath to accommodate a wheelchair. The bath and shower area is separated and equipped with grab bars, a sliding entry door, and a shower chair. A height-adjustable shower head is installed. Emergency call buttons are located adjacent to the bed and in the bathroom.
Mobility aids such as wheelchairs, a standing assist rail, and a towel bag for transporting amenities are available upon request, subject to availability.
Common areas of Hotel Nikko Style Nagoya, including the lobby, café-bar, restaurant, and elevators, are designed to be step-free. A wheelchair-accessible toilet is located on the first floor near the lobby. This facility includes grab bars, an ostomate-compatible toilet, a diaper-changing station, and space sufficient for an accompanying person or child. One accessible parking space is available by advance reservation.
Communication support for guests with hearing impairments includes written communication tools such as writing boards and tablets available at the front desk.
Guests with visual impairments may be accompanied by guide dogs. The hotel can provide water and food bowls upon request. Staff are trained to assist guests with visual impairments to guest rooms or on-site facilities as needed.
Lighting in guest rooms is adjustable. The hotel utilizes aroma diffusers in public areas; however, the scent is not strong.
Hotel Nikko Style Nagoya also offers multilingual support in English, Chinese, Korean, Indonesian, and Vietnamese. Dietary accommodations including vegetarian, vegan, gluten-free, and low-allergen meals can be prepared with advance notice.
